Antique Meissen "Monkey Band" orchestra figurine, I believe to be perhaps the conductor of the orchestra. Part of a collection that I have had for many years; I think from the 18th century. I inherited these figurines long ago. Standing 5 3/4 inches tall with beautifully detailed face and clothing. Marked on the bottom with the blue crossed swords, the number "18" in red, and incised number in the porcelain "120". There is some damage to the figurine (it seems that very few of these early Meissen figurines survived without damage). The left hand is broken at the cuff and is missing. I assume this hand held the conductor's baton and it is missing also. At the top and bottom of this left hand cuff are chips. There is also a chip on the right hand cuff that the figurine has placed on his hip. The toes of the right foot are broken and missing. There is also a small chip at the top of the back of the hat and also one chip at the bottom of the left hand side of the jacket. Most of this damage is shown in the pictures. All of this damage could be restored by a professional ceramic or porcelain artist. I had intended to have it restored, but never got around to it.
